1. Pressure Rating Basics

Pressure rating refers to the maximum allowable pressure that a PPR fitting can withstand without experiencing deformation, leakage, or failure. The pressure rating is typically provided by manufacturers and is expressed in units of pressure, such as bar or pounds per square inch (psi). Understanding the pressure rating of PPR fittings is essential to ensure that the fittings can handle the specific pressure demands of the plumbing system.

2. System Compatibility

Pressure ratings help determine the compatibility of PPR fittings with the plumbing system. Different plumbing systems may require varying pressure levels based on their intended applications. By understanding the pressure ratings of PPR fittings, users can select fittings that match the required pressure range of their specific plumbing system. Using fittings with lower pressure ratings than necessary can lead to potential failures, while using fittings with higher pressure ratings can be unnecessary and costly.
